Which point is located at (4, –2)? On a coordinate plane, point A is 2 units to the left and 4 units up. Point B is 4 units to t

he right and 2 units down. Point C is 4 units to the left and 2 units up. Point D is 2 units to the right and 4 units down. A B C D
Mathematics
2 answers:
ycow [4]2 years ago
7 0

Answer:

Point B is 4 units to the right and 2 units down

Step-by-step explanation:

Since our <em>x</em> is positive, we are going to the right of the x-axis (where positive values lay).

Since our <em>y</em> is negative, we are going down in the y-axis (where negative values lay).

igor_vitrenko [27]2 years ago
6 0

Answer: point B matches (4,-2)

Step-by-step explanation:

Within parentheses, the first number is the x-coordinate. Positive numbers are given without the +sign and they go to the Right. Negative -numbers go to the left.

The second number is the y-coordinate. Positive numbers go up, -numbers that are negative go down.

In this example it will be 4 Right and 2 Down.

The aquarium has 10 more red fish than blue fish. 60 percent of the fish are red. How many blue fish are in the aquarium?
guajiro [1.7K]

Answer:

20 blue fish

Step-by-step explanation:

Number of blue fish = x

Number of red fish = x+10

Red fish = 60% of total = 0.6

Total fish = x+x+10 = 2x+10

0.6 = (x+10)/(2x+10)

Solve for x:

1.2x+6 = x+10

0.2x = 4

x = 20

A house is being purchased at the price of $138,000.00. The 30-year mortgage has a 10% down payment at an interest rate of 4.875
Mama L [17]

Answer:

  $238,600

Step-by-step explanation:

The amount being borrowed is 100% -10% = 90% of the purchase price, or ...

  0.90 × $138,000 = $124,200.

Then the monthly payment can be computed using the amortization formula:

  A = P(r/12)/(1 -(1 +r/12)^(-12t))

  A = 124200(.04875/12)/(1 -(1 +.04875/12)^(-12·30)) ≈ 657.28

and the total repaid is ...

  (360 months) × ($657.28/month) = $236,619.58*

The cost of mortgage insurance is considered part of the cost of the loan. That amount is ...

  (77 months) × ($25.88/month) = $1992.76

so the total amount paid for the loan is ...

  $236,619.58 +1992.76 = $238,612.34

The cost of the loan is about $238,600.

_____

* In figuring the total repayment cost, we used the full-precision value for the loan payment. The actual repayment amount will depend on the rounded value of the loan payment and the way the final payment is made. When rounded to the nearest $100, these details become unimportant.

Find all the zeros of the equation 12x^2-64=-x^4
Natalija [7]

Answer: all the zeroes of the above equation will be

(x-4)(x+4)(x-2)(x+2)

Step-by-step explanation:

Since we  have given that

12x^2-64=-x^4\\\\x^4+12x^2-64=0

We need to find the zeroes of the above equation.

So, we will use  "Split the middle terms" :

x^4+12x^2-64=0\\\\x^4+16x^2-4x^2-64=0\\\\x^2(x^2-16)-4(x^2-16)=0\\\\(x^2-4)(x^2-16)=0\\\\x^2-4=0\ or\ x^2-16=0\\\\\text{ "Using }a^2-b^2=(a+b)(a-b)"\\\\x^2-4=x^2-2^2=(x-2)(x+2)\\\\x^2-16=x^2-4^2=(x+4)(x-4)

So, all the zeroes of the above equation will be

(x-4)(x+4)(x-2)(x+2)
